Im heading to the track tomorrow and going for low 10,s with razors kit;) Im not going to go to crazy with the boost and timing the first time to the track:D 92 octane 20 Deg timing and 24-25# boost to see if that gets me 10.2 - 10.4 and over the 130mph mark... The car has run a best of 10.65 on 20 Deg timing and 16# boost so i think it should :) My motor is getting a little on the loose side (piston noise) from 4 years of street and track beatings so i hope it lives ;)

Adjusting did help some but I was concerned about the drag. Try pulling off your rear drums and scuff up the pads and drums with some sandpaper. I had lost the ability to hold boost at the line also and this worked for me.
Looking to hear your results. Would like to know if you had to change your target A/F ratio. That has been my only concern with a FAST system. (Will fuel be pulled to compensate for the added alky? What would be a perfect alky/gas ratio?) With the stock ECM cars it is not a problem and they run great. In theory FAST should work better but it would just take some tuning. My alky system is only 90 percent installed and have not gotten to the tuning yet. Good luck

3600# with me in it:)
I just didnt get enough passes loged to lean the middle of the fuel map out more and smooth the timing map out:( I know the car would have hit a 9 if it would have spooled faster. My 60ft were not as good as i wanted because my brakes wouldnt hold much boost.The car was lazy about 10ft out but it was getting there.... Oh well at least i didnt hurt it:D
